Synopsis

Weapon X (2017 series) #4 synopsis by Peter Silvestro
Rating: 4.5 stars

Story continues from TOTALLY AWESOME HULK #19.

Hulk (Amadeus Cho) shows his teammates the layout of the Weapon X lab in a Roxxon oil rig in the Gulf of Mexico: they are trying to save Lady Deathstrike, capture the scientists, and smash the Weapon X cyborgs. Old Man Logan, Sabretooth, and Domino are armed and ready. They dive from the airship and fight the cyborg sentries, destroying them all. Entering the building, Hulk is attacked by twenty cyborgs, watched from Washington by the mysterious leader who doesn’t think Hulk can handle it. And he can’t—until Sabretooth shoots him in the face, his sudden rage increasing his strength. They make it to the lab and while Hulk is battling more cyborgs, the others free Deathstrike and Warpath who join the battle. They corner the scientists and the angry Yuriko is ready to slaughter them out of revenge for the horrors they put her through but Hulk stops her, insisting they’re the good guys and asking them to name their boss. The boss, however, gives the signal to destroy the facility and only the heroes survive—and a mechanized bird delivers the sample of Hulk’s DNA to the big boss, Reverend William Stryker….

Story continues in WEAPONS OF MUTANT DESTRUCTION: ALPHA.

Review / Commentaries


Weapon X (2017 series) #4 Review by (April 21, 2020)

Review: An all-action issue, tightly plotted and extravagantly design to maximize the thrills. Hulk meets his match in twenty cyborgs and we learn Lady Deathstrike is not the forgiving type (no kidding? Look at her name!). And Stryker is a bad dude.
